Overview

Student clubs play a vital role in fostering a dynamic and engaging campus environment at Mar Thoma College for Women, Perumbavoor. Beyond academics, these clubs provide students with a platform to explore their interests, develop essential skills, and cultivate a vibrant community. The club activities for the academic year 2024-2025 commenced on January 20, 2025, under the initiative of the Principal, Dr. Letha P. Cheriyan. The overall coordination of these activities was managed by the General Convenor, Dr. Vinod V., along with the respective club convenors and assistant coordinators.

RULES FOR SMOOTH CONDUCT AND EVALUATION OF ACTIVITIES

General Guidelines for Smooth Conduct

  • Structured PlanningEach activity should have a detailed plan, including objectives, timeline, budget, and expected outcomes. This will ensure clarity and accountability.
  • Regular MeetingsThe club should conduct bi-weekly meetings with staff coordinators, student leaders, and activity committees to review progress and plan upcoming activities.
  • Activity CalendarPrepare an annual calendar of activities at the beginning of the academic year. Assign responsibilities and set clear deadlines.
  • Role DefinitionDefine specific roles for each committee member and ensure adherence to responsibilities to avoid confusion.
  • InclusivityEncourage participation from students across disciplines and create opportunities for diverse contributions.
  • DocumentationMaintain records of all activities, including minutes of meetings, attendance, photographs, and reports, in both digital and physical formats.
  • Code of ConductAll members must adhere to ethical behaviour during activities. Respect for nature, heritage sites, and community members is paramount.
  • Communication ProtocolAll communications regarding activities (including invitations and reports) should go through the Secretary under the supervision of the Coordinator.

Monitoring and Evaluation Framework

  • Activity Reports: Each activity committee should submit a post-activity report to the Coordinator, detailing objectives, participation, outcomes, challenges faced, and suggestions for improvement.
  • Feedback Mechanism: Collect feedback from participants through surveys or feedback forms. This will help assess the effectiveness and engagement of the activities.
  • Performance Reviews: Conduct quarterly reviews to evaluate the progress of the club’s objectives. Highlight successes and address areas for improvement.
  • Participation MetricsTrack and evaluate student participation in terms of quantity (number of participants) and quality (active involvement, contributions).
  • Outcome Assessment: Measure the impact of activities against the club’s objectives, such as improved awareness, practical skill acquisition, or collaborations achieved.
  • Recognition and Awards: Recognize outstanding contributions through certificates, awards, or mentions during the Annual Nature and Heritage Festival to motivate members.
